1 Jan 1642 Jahr - theaking-rake
Beschreibung:
A small rake used by thatchers. One example noted, in the East Riding: 1606 <i>a turfe spade an old hedged helme a drag & a theaking rake</i>, South Cave (Kaner220). In his description of how stacks were thatched Henry Best wrote: 1642 <i>there are to bee two folks, viz. one to sitte beside the strawe and feede the bande therewith and another to goe backewards with the rake to drawe forth and twine the same,</i> Elmswell (DW64).
